High-k polymer gate dielectrics are desirable for oxide thin-film transistors but limited by low capacitance and interfacial instability. Here; pyridinophane-based polymers with main-chain heteroatoms are processed via a Gorham-type chemical vapor polymerization to form ultrathin; pinhole-free dielectrics with enhanced dielectric properties and reliable oxide transistor performance.
